Bornella adamsi Gray, 1850

Environment:  demersal; marine; depth range - 3 m
Distribution:  Indo-Pacific: South Africa and Hawaii.
Diagnosis:   
Biology:  Found from the intertidal fringe to 3 m. Feeds on thecate hydroids (Ref. 866).
